Honda Unveils New 0 Series Platform for Electric Vehicles

Honda has officially announced its new 0 Series platform for electric vehicles, promising a range of innovative features and technologies aimed at enhancing performance, safety, and sustainability. The 0 Series platform is set to revolutionize the electric vehicle market with its cutting-edge design and production techniques.

The new platform will feature different battery options, with smaller models equipped with a pack of around 50kWh and larger models boasting a pack of approximately 100kWh. It remains unclear if multiple battery options will be available for each model, providing flexibility for consumers based on their driving needs.

Incorporating mega-casting and advanced production techniques, Honda aims to increase the platform’s rigidity while reducing weight. The use of ‘3D friction stir welding’ and ‘constant DC chopping’ (CDC) spot welding allows for the joining of metals without melting them, resulting in greater rigidity and decreased deformation. This will enhance the overall driving experience and safety of the vehicles.

Furthermore, Honda has developed the body structure of the 0 Series platform to disperse the impact of collisions to the side of the structure, minimizing the space required for battery protection at the front and rear. This design feature highlights Honda’s commitment to safety and innovation in electric vehicle technology.

The 0 Series Saloon is expected to weigh approximately 100kg less than current EVs of its size, contributing to a more enjoyable driving experience. The vehicle will feature a steer-by-wire throttle system, potentially incorporating the yoke design from the concept car. The integration of the control unit with the suspension, brakes, and regen system will enhance handling and responsiveness.

Active aerodynamics will play a crucial role in improving efficiency and performance, with the ability to channel air underneath the car through sculpted bodywork, providing up to six additional miles of range and generating downforce. The use of 3D gyro sensors, originally developed for Honda’s humanoid robots, will automatically stabilize the vehicle, ensuring a smooth and controlled driving experience.

The lightweight aluminum frame of the 0 Series platform is designed to flex during cornering, redistributing load onto the outside wheels for improved cornering balance. All 0 Series models will be software-defined vehicles, capable of receiving over-the-air software updates to access new features and upgrades, ensuring they remain cutting-edge and adaptable to evolving technologies.

With a focus on autonomy, the 0 Series models will offer up to level-three autonomy in specific scenarios, thanks to a range of advanced sensors including cameras, radar, and lidar. Production of the 0 Series models will commence at Honda’s Ohio plant, with plans to adapt the production line to accommodate both ICE and EV cars. A new plant dedicated to EV production, along with a battery plant, will be constructed in Ontario, Canada by 2028, demonstrating Honda’s commitment to sustainable and innovative manufacturing practices.
